12:13 27 March, 2026The Prince of Wales visited the 1st Battalion of the Mercian Regiment in Bulford, Wiltshire, on March 26.
During a morning coffee with officers, soldiers, and their families in the officers’ mess, the prince discussed the possibility of changing his appearance, inspired by the style of some service members. According to the Daily Mail, William admired their mustaches and remarked: “I might shave my beard and keep the mustache.”
Since the summer of 2024, Prince William has sported a neatly trimmed beard, marking a departure from his decades-long clean-shaven look (apart from a brief holiday stubble in December 2008). He first appeared with the beard in August 2024 in a video address to Team UK for the Summer Olympics in Paris, alongside his wife, Catherine, Princess of Wales.
However, a few weeks later, during a visit to a church near Balmoral Castle in Scotland with Princess Catherine, the beard was gone, raising questions about whether the new style would last. After returning from summer break in September 2024, William resumed appearing in public with the beard, and it has remained his signature look since.
Former aide Jason Knauf told 60 Minutes Australia in February 2025 that the beard continues only with Princess Catherine’s approval. “If she didn’t like it, it wouldn’t be there. I can confirm that,” he said. Knauf added that the prince takes his style seriously: “I tried to discuss it with him, but he just said, ‘The beard is there. End of story. No more talk.’”
Prince William also revealed that his first 2024 beard didn’t last because of a strong reaction from his daughter, Princess Charlotte. “Charlotte didn’t like it, she cried, so I had to shave it off. Then I grew it back and convinced her it was fine,” he shared previously.
Interestingly, according to Prince Harry’s memoir Spare, William had felt a twinge of jealousy when Queen Elizabeth allowed Harry to wear a beard at his wedding to Meghan Markle in 2018, despite the British Army’s rules against facial hair at the time. The Duke of Sussex has kept a beard since 2013, which has become a hallmark of his style.
